Strumentazione del codice sorgente

In informatica , strumentazione codice sorgente è il processo di aggiunta di ulteriori istruzioni macchina ad un programma per computer senza richiedere la modifica del l' originale codice sorgente . È correlato alla strumentazione nella scienza , da cui il nome.

Spiegazione

La compilazione del codice sorgente di un programma genera un binario ( eseguibile o codice oggetto ) o il bytecode .
La strumentazione interviene dopo la compilazione per aggiungere ulteriori istruzioni al binario generato. Può intervenire anche durante la compilazione. In questo caso, le istruzioni vengono aggiunte in aggiunta alle istruzioni normalmente generate dal codice sorgente.

Le istruzioni aggiunte vengono poi eseguite insieme alle altre durante l'esecuzione del programma.

uso

Le istruzioni aggiunte dipendono dallo scopo che deve essere raggiunto dalla strumentazione.

Vedi anche